![]() |
PIP 5.5.3
Platform-Independent Primitives
|
Полный список членов класса PIBlockingQueue< T >, включая наследуемые из базового класса
| capacity() | PIBlockingQueue< T > | inline |
| PIQueue::capacity() const | PIDeque< T > | inlineprivate |
| drainTo(PIDeque< T > &other, size_t maxCount=SIZE_MAX) | PIBlockingQueue< T > | inline |
| drainTo(PIBlockingQueue< T > &other, size_t maxCount=SIZE_MAX) | PIBlockingQueue< T > | inline |
| PIQueue::enqueue(T &&v) | PIQueue< T > | inlineprivate |
| offer(const T &v, PISystemTime timeout={}) | PIBlockingQueue< T > | inline |
| PIBlockingQueue(size_t capacity=SIZE_MAX, PIConditionVariable *cond_var_add=new PIConditionVariable(), PIConditionVariable *cond_var_rem=new PIConditionVariable()) | PIBlockingQueue< T > | inlineexplicit |
| PIBlockingQueue(const PIDeque< T > &other) | PIBlockingQueue< T > | inlineexplicit |
| PIBlockingQueue(PIBlockingQueue< T > &other) | PIBlockingQueue< T > | inline |
| poll(PISystemTime timeout={}, const T &defaultVal=T(), bool *isOk=nullptr) | PIBlockingQueue< T > | inline |
| put(const T &v) | PIBlockingQueue< T > | inline |
| remainingCapacity() | PIBlockingQueue< T > | inline |
| size() | PIBlockingQueue< T > | inline |
| PIQueue::size() const | PIDeque< T > | inlineprivate |
| take() | PIBlockingQueue< T > | inline |